1840 2d Blue Plate 1 Entire
QV 1840 SG5 2d Blue Plate 1 (E-E). A Fine quality stamp with 4 good margins all round tied by a light Red MX to a small folded Entire dated 17th August 1840 addressed from Birmingham to London.
The entire is clean with a central filing fold well clear of the stamp. The letter appears to be between two friends and details building renovation work and the search for suitable antique materials.
For the purposes of complete accuracy, I would mention some very minor splitting along some of the cover folds.
The cover has a Proschold certificate.
